Transaction 2811489e25789fe0c40264daffa8a4a8cba4918fbd9eec5bf90fc198e6fbc055
2 Input
2 Outputs
- 2811489e25789fe0c40264daffa8a4a8cba4918fbd9eec5bf90fc198e6fbc055:0
- 2811489e25789fe0c40264daffa8a4a8cba4918fbd9eec5bf90fc198e6fbc055:1
value 1008763
address 1tG8yEwvp7Dy4HiLCnUnGs24XcgnggkBd
value 20000
address 1DxQxo5ioesGhGS92bFisw3uC4AcWYNBDR